An IV tubing clamp is a small mechanical device used to control or stop the flow of fluids through IV tubing. Often integrated into disposable infusion sets, these clamps provide nurses and medical staff with a quick and efficient method to regulate intravenous therapies. There are various types of clamps — roller clamps, slide clamps, and pinch clamps — each offering different levels of control depending on the application.
These clamps are typically made of medical-grade plastic to ensure durability, compatibility with IV fluids, and safety for patient contact. Despite their simplicity, they are indispensable in daily hospital, clinic, and homecare operations.
1. Precise Flow Control
One of the primary functions of IV tubing clamps is accurate fluid regulation. Roller clamps, in particular, are designed to finely adjust the drip rate of IV fluids, ensuring that patients receive the right volume of medication or hydration over a specified period. This is crucial in managing therapies such as antibiotics, pain medications, or electrolyte solutions, where precise dosing is critical.
2. Preventing Air Embolism
A common but potentially fatal complication in IV therapy is an air embolism — when air enters the bloodstream. IV clamps play a key role in preventing this by sealing off the tubing before air can be introduced. Especially during bag changes or disconnections, a quick slide of the clamp ensures patient safety without the need for complex tools.
3. Infection Control
Proper use of IV tubing clamps also supports infection prevention. Clamping the tube before disconnecting or inserting components minimizes the risk of contaminants entering the line. 4. Enhancing Workflow Efficiency
Medical personnel operate under high-pressure conditions where every second counts. IV tubing clamps allow healthcare providers to quickly stop or start fluid flow without disconnecting or replacing any components. This helps reduce treatment delays and allows for smoother bedside operations.
As healthcare systems in developing nations continue to expand, the demand for affordable, reliable, and standardized IV components has surged. IV tubing clamps are a critical part of this demand, ensuring consistent care delivery regardless of location. Manufacturers around the world are focusing on producing non-DEHP and latex-free clamps, responding to rising concerns about chemical exposure and allergies.
Additionally, international quality standards, such as ISO 8536 for infusion equipment, are shaping the global market by pushing for better design, precision, and safety. The medical device industry is increasingly adopting eco-conscious practices. Today’s IV tubing clamps are not only expected to be safe and effective but also environmentally responsible. Manufacturers are transitioning to biocompatible and recyclable materials to reduce environmental impact, while still maintaining sterile conditions and high performance.
While the basic function of IV clamps remains the same, innovation is driving improvements in:
· Ergonomics: Easier handling for nurses, even with gloves.
· Color coding: Faster identification and workflow organization.
· Material strength: Ensuring reliability under pressure and frequent use.
· Sterility packaging: Preventing contamination before use.
These advancements contribute directly to better patient care, fewer errors, and higher staff satisfaction.
